Abstract
A kind of copper clad laminate prepreg separating device with air blowing clamping jaw, including the clamping jaw (1) with upper clip arm (11) and lower clip arm (12), valve (2) is provided below in the lower clip arm (12) of the clamping jaw (1), and the opening direction of the valve (2) is identical with the opening direction of clamping jaw (1).When the utility model separates pp, one is not result in PP injureds, Improving The Quality of Products;Two be that individual PP can change directly alignment storehouse, so as to improve operating efficiency, lift production capacity when stacking operation without the storehouse that misplaces.
Description
Technical field
The utility model belongs to copper clad laminate (CLL) production technical field, is related to copper clad laminate prepreg separating device,
Especially a kind of copper clad laminate prepreg separating device with air blowing clamping jaw.
Background technology
At present, CCL is first staggeredly put prepreg (PP) for 2 inches by every part of embryo material, automatic by gripper during automatic overlapping
Every part of embryo material formula separation of gripping, when running into the CCL separation of individual PP embryo material:One is that clamping type PP separation is easily pressed from both sides when pressing from both sides individual PP
Take improper and skew PP, draw PP just, so as to influence production capacity after needing operating personnel's pause machine;Two are, clamping type PP separation
PP injureds are easily caused, filler is not enough and produce local starved when causing the substrate to press, and influences substrate quality.
Based on this, spy proposes the utility model.
The content of the invention
The utility model is to install a set of blowning installation additional on existing, when running into the CCL of individual PP embryo material from fold
During conjunction, by blowning installation by individual PP embryo material on upper strata from multiple following overlap PP embryo materials in separate, can reach and not press from both sides
Hinder PP effect.
Therefore, the purpose of this utility model is to provide the pp separators that a kind of clamping type and assimilating type complement one another, with
Improve production capacity, do not damage pp.
The technical solution of the utility model is:A kind of copper clad laminate prepreg separating device with air blowing clamping jaw, bag
The clamping jaw with upper clip arm and lower clip arm is included, valve, the opening direction of the valve is provided below in the lower clip arm of the clamping jaw
It is identical with the opening direction of clamping jaw.
Further, the A/F of the valve is more smaller than the width of lower clip arm.The A/F of valve is less than lower folder
The width of arm, can allow jaw size to minimize.
Further, the A/F of the valve is the 1/2~2/3 of the width of lower clip arm.
Alternatively, the opening of the valve is made up of several spileholes spaced apart.
Further, the opening of the valve is made up of 3 spileholes spaced apart.
Further, the clamping jaw is furnished with telescoping mechanism, and the telescoping mechanism is by main controller controls.Pass through master controller
The valve in clamping jaw and clamping jaw is controlled, target pp can be allowed to be gripped from the pp being stacked and come out.
The utility model is to install a set of blowning installation additional on clamping type separation equipment, and individual PP is without staggeredly heap during absorption
Pile, multiple PP structures need combine every part of material and the stacking that interlocks by technological design, in order to the separation of clamping jaw clamping type, when running into
When the CCL of individual PP embryo material is overlapped automatically, start valve blow gas, individual PP embryo material on upper strata is overlapped from multiple following
Separated in PP embryo materials, can reach the effect for not crushing PP.Because gripping individual PP without staggeredly stacking, used instead during stacking straight
Alignment storehouse is connect, staggeredly process can be simplified manually, be conducive to the raising of operating efficiency.
It is proven, during the utility model separation pp, one is not result in PP injureds, Improving The Quality of Products;Two be single
Directly alignment storehouse can be changed without the storehouse that misplaces by opening when PP stacks operation, so that operating efficiency is improved, lifting production capacity.
